    Ok, when did you start seeing this? Did you just start sending to Exchange Online from this IP? Exchange Online will greylist and back off connections it hasnt seen before in some cases. Especially if they are "spammy" in nature. Usually, after that iniitial back off period, EOP will allow these and they will go through
